West Columbia Fire Department is a career department in South Carolina focused on keeping crews equipped and apparatus in service.
Fleet, inventory, and operational data were spread across spreadsheets, emails, and handwritten notes which slowed maintenance reporting.
The department implemented First Due Assets & Inventory to centralize fleet records, apparatus checks, work orders, and inventory workflows.
Operational friction decreased while fleet maintenance reporting became faster and apparatus swaps became significantly quicker.
